Awareness Programme on “Use of Biomass in Thermal Power Plant” organised under Mission Samarth

Rajpura, January 17: A one day training-cum-awareness programme on “Use of Biomass in Thermal Power Plant” was organised at Rajpura under Mission Samarth in collaboration with Ministry of Power, Government of India. The awareness programme was attended by Mission officials, more than 200 farmers, FPOs, TPP officials, bankers, entrepreneurs and pellet manufacturers.

Dr. M. Ravichandra Babu, Director, NPTI, Nangal delivered the welcome address and highlighted the objectives of the Mission and benefits of pellet manufacturing in thermal power plants for farmers. Mohammad Nizamuddin, AGM NTPC and Member, Samarth Mission addressed the gathering and discussed technical and financial aspects of biomass availability and supply chain management. He also encouraged FPOs, new entrepreneurs to work in this field.
Chief Agriculture Officer Dr. Jaswinder Singh while addressing highlighted the availability of biomass in Rajpura, he motivated the farmers to make straw pellets for use of biomass in thermal power plants. SDM Rajpura Avikesh Gupta inaugurated the event as chief guest and while addressing the audience he informed about various schemes being run by the government for farmers and entrepreneurs.
